Mass Effect 1 was so fundamentally different from 2 and 3 in its scope, I always felt that they used all the good ideas and then fell back on bad character drama and sci-fi cliche. I really liked how the original didn't have reloadable weapons, and how you actually explored uncharted worlds, and how the main quest worlds generally had multiple ways to complete an objective. You were the first human to really kick rear end and take names in a galaxy run by aliens, while trying not to embarrass humanity too much. Teammates died on your orders, and there was nothing you could do to stop it. Even the things that people complained about took some basic level of player skill. Trying to defuse a ticking bomb by playing frogger was something I'll always remember about that drat game. ME1 felt new and ambitious and it stood apart from every other shooter and RPG on the market, so I think that was enough to excuse its mechanical shortcomings. 2 and 3 just turned into linear cover shooters, right down to the guns with pitifully low ammo (excuse me, *heat sinks*). The hacking mechanic turned into "hold down the hack button for three seconds and the door will unlock." Everybody acted like humans had been running around in the galaxy for centuries - instead of literally 25 years - and every alien in the galaxy seemed to have a bunch of lifelong human friends. And, of course, the female characters now went into battle dressed like strippers, for reasons. The ME1 -> 2 -> 3 progression almost mirrors Dragon Age Origins -> 2 -> Inquisition. All style and no substance. And now Andromeda doesn't even have style. I mean, jeez, that Twitter video from Handsome Ralph. Man. ME1 is one of my favorite games, and I replay it every couple years. I was really hoping for more out of Andromeda.
